    Goulash Delight: Hearty European Stew with Crusty Baguette

    Goulash Delight is a traditional European stew that warms both the heart and the soul. With its rich, savory flavors and tender chunks of meat, this dish is perfect for a cozy night in or a gathering with friends. Pair it with a crusty baguette, and you have a meal that will leave everyone asking for seconds.     Ingredients

    • 2 lbs beef chuck, cut into 1-inch cubes
    •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
    • 1 large onion, chopped
    • 3 cloves garlic, minced
    • 2 tablespoons sweet paprika
    • 1 teaspoon caraway seeds
    •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
    • 2 cups beef broth
    • 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
    • 2 medium potatoes, peeled and diced
    • 2 carrots, sliced
    • 1 bell pepper, chopped
    • Salt and black pepper to taste
    • Fresh parsley for garnish
    • Crusty baguette, for serving

    Cooking Instructions

    1. Sear the Meat: In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Add the beef cubes in batches, ensuring not to overcrowd the pot. Sear the meat on all sides until browned,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the beef and set aside.

    2. Sauté Aromatics: In the same pot, add the chopped onion and cook until transl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the minced garlic and sauté for an additional minute, releasing its fragrant aroma.

    3. Spice It Up: Stir in the paprika, caraway seeds, and thyme, allowing the spices to bloom in the oil for about 30 seconds. This step is crucial for developing a deep, rich flavor in your goulash.

    4. Combine Ingredients: Return the seared beef to the pot. Pour in the beef broth and add the diced tomatoes.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over the pot and let it simmer for 1.5 hours, stirring occasionally.

    5. Add Vegetables: After 1.5 hours, add the diced potatoes, carrots, and bell pepper. Season with salt and black pepper to taste. Cover and simmer for an additional 30-45 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and the beef is fork-tender.

    6. Serve: Once your goulash is ready, ladle it into bowls and garnish with freshly chopped parsley. Serve alongside slices of crusty baguette to soak up all the delicious juices.

    Cooking Tips

    • Meat Selection: For the best flavor and texture, use beef chuck or brisket. These cuts become tender during long cooking times and are full of flavor.

    • Paprika Choices: Sweet paprika is traditional, but feel free to experiment with smoked paprika for a different flavor profile.

    • Vegetable Variations: You can adapt the vegetable mix based on your preferences. For a twist, try adding peas, green beans, or even mushrooms.

    • Make it Ahead: Goulash tastes even better the next day! Prepare it ahead of time, let it cool, refrigerate, and reheat when ready to serve.

    • Serving Suggestions: A side salad or pickled vegetables can complement the hearty flavors of the goulash, adding freshness to your meal.

    Pairing Suggestions

    A robust red wine, such as a Cabernet Sauvignon or a Malbec, pairs beautifully with the rich flavors of goulash. Alternatively, a crisp lager or a hearty stout can also enhance your dining experience.
